研究生软件论文范文

研究生软件论文范文

随着计算机技术的发展,软件开发已成为研究生学习和研究的重要领域之一。在软件开发的过程中,如何设计一个好的软件系统是至关重要的。本文旨在探讨软件系统设计的一般方法和技巧,以及如何通过研究生软件论文的形式进行阐述。

一、软件系统设计的一般方法和技巧

1.需求分析

需求分析是软件系统设计的第一步。在进行需求分析时,应明确系统的目标、用户的需求、系统的功能、性能、可靠性等方面的要求。需求分析的结果应转化为系统的需求规格说明书,以便在软件开发过程中遵循。

2.设计模式

设计模式是一种软件开发中常用的模板或解决方案。设计模式可以帮助开发人员在软件开发过程中快速解决问题,提高软件系统的可维护性和可扩展性。常见的设计模式包括工厂模式、单例模式、观察者模式等。

3.架构设计

架构设计是软件系统设计的重要部分。架构设计应考虑系统的可扩展性、可维护性、可重用性等方面的要求。常见的架构设计包括MVC模式、MVP模式、MVVM模式等。

4.软件测试

软件测试是保证软件系统质量的重要环节。软件测试应包括单元测试、集成测试、系统测试等方面的内容。软件测试的结果应转化为测试报告,以便开发人员了解系统的质量情况。

5.软件部署

软件部署是软件系统安装、运行和维护的重要环节。软件部署应考虑系统的可扩展性、可维护性、安全性等方面的要求。常见的软件部署方法包括打包部署、容器化部署、远程部署等。

二、如何通过研究生软件论文的形式进行阐述

1.论文结构

研究生软件论文的结构应包括引言、研究方法、软件系统设计、需求分析、设计模式、架构设计、测试报告、软件部署等方面的内容。

2.研究方法

研究方法是研究生软件论文的核心部分。研究方法应考虑系统的可扩展性、可维护性、可重用性等方面的要求。常用的研究方法包括问卷调查、案例分析、实验研究等。

3.论文内容

论文内容应包括软件系统设计的目的、方法、结果和结论。论文内容应清晰、简洁、准确地阐述软件系统设计的一般方法和技巧,以及如何通过研究生软件论文的形式进行阐述。

4.论文格式

论文格式是研究生软件论文的重要部分。论文格式应考虑论文的页码、页眉页脚、参考文献格式、字体、字号、行距、页边距等方面的要求。论文格式应清晰、简洁、准确地阐述软件系统设计的一般方法和技巧,以及如何通过研究生软件论文的形式进行阐述。

综上所述,软件系统设计的一般方法和技巧以及如何通过研究生软件论文的形式进行阐述是研究生学习和研究的重要领域之一。通过本文的介绍,希望可以帮助读者更好地理解和掌握软件系统设计的一般方法和技巧,以及如何通过研究生软件论文的形式进行阐述。

点击进入下载PDF全文
QQ咨询
Baidu
map